The time it takes to retrieve data in response to queries from users. It helps ensure that data is available in a timely manner to support decision-making.
In today’s fast-paced world, businesses need to make quick decisions to stay ahead of the competition. To make these quick decisions, businesses require data that is readily available. Query response time is an important metric that measures the time it takes to retrieve data in response to queries from users. It helps ensure that data is available in a timely manner to support decision-making. In this article, we will unveil the secrets to mastering query response time and achieving speed and accuracy.
Mastering Query Response Time: Unveiling the Secrets
- Optimize database design: The database design plays a crucial role in query response time. A well-designed database can significantly improve the performance of queries. The database should be normalized and indexed appropriately to reduce the time it takes to retrieve data.
- Use caching: Caching is a technique used to store frequently accessed data in memory. This reduces the time it takes to retrieve data from the database. Caching can be implemented at various levels, such as database level, application level, and web server level.
- Use query optimization techniques: Query optimization techniques such as query tuning, index tuning, and database tuning can improve query performance. These techniques can reduce the time it takes to retrieve data and improve the accuracy of results.
- Use load balancing: Load balancing is a technique used to distribute the load across multiple servers. This can improve query response time by reducing the load on individual servers.
Achieving Speed and Accuracy: Insights on Query Response Time
- Monitor query response time: Monitoring query response time is essential to ensure that the system is performing optimally. It helps identify performance bottlenecks and areas for improvement.
- Use performance testing: Performance testing is a technique used to simulate a load on the system and measure its response time. It helps identify the maximum load that the system can handle and the response time at different load levels.
- Use profiling tools: Profiling tools can be used to analyze the performance of the system. They can help identify code-level bottlenecks and suggest improvements.
- Prioritize queries: Prioritizing queries based on their importance can help ensure that critical queries are responded to quickly. This can improve decision-making and ensure that the business is running smoothly.
Query response time is an important metric that businesses need to monitor and optimize to make data-driven decisions. By optimizing database design, using caching, query optimization techniques, load balancing, monitoring query response time, using performance testing, profiling tools, and prioritizing queries, businesses can achieve speed and accuracy in query response time. This will help them stay ahead of the competition and make data-driven decisions in a timely manner.